For … WebDec 21, 2024 · An employer, however, cannot be held liable for an off-duty (or on-duty) employee’s tortious conduct motivated by personal malice. For employer liability, the conduct must be an “outgrowth” of the employment, “inherent in the working environment,” or “typical of or broadly incidental to the enterprise.”.

WebMay 10, 2016 · Employers: Be Prepared. Vicarious liability places a heavy burden upon employers to ensure their employees obey traffic laws. When it is necessary for an employee to operate a vehicle, all restrictions on use of that vehicle should be in writing and acknowledged by the employee.
